The Chew season 5 episode 93, titled "$10 Potluck!", is an exciting and budget-friendly episode that celebrates the joy of potlucks! The show's hosts, Carla Hall, Michael Symon, Mario Batali, Clinton Kelly, and Daphne Oz, showcase delicious and creative recipes that can be made for under $10 per dish.

The episode begins with a lively discussion about the importance of potlucks in building communities and fostering relationships. The hosts share their own experiences with potlucks and reminisce about their favorite potluck dishes.

Carla Hall takes charge of the first recipe, which is a tasty and budget-friendly twist on a classic dish. She shows the audience how to make her "Hot Chicken and Potato Salad" dish, featuring chicken thighs, potatoes, and a spicy sauce made with hot sauce, honey, and vinegar. The dish not only looks delicious, but it's also easy to make and won't break the bank.

Next up, Michael Symon shares his recipe for "Sriracha Deviled Eggs," which adds a spicy kick to the popular party food. The recipe only requires a few ingredients, including eggs, mayo, and Sriracha, making it a great option for those on a budget.

Mario Batali takes on the challenge of creating a vegetarian dish for under $10 and shows the audience how to make "Penne with Charred Broccoli and Cauliflower." His dish features penne pasta combined with roasted vegetables and a flavorful sauce made with garlic and lemon juice. This dish is not only affordable, but it's also a healthy and satisfying option for vegetarians and meat-eaters alike.

Clinton Kelly demonstrates his recipe for "Buffalo Chicken Meatballs," which are perfect for any potluck party. His dish combines ground chicken with a spicy sauce made with buffalo sauce and a touch of butter. The meatballs are easy to make and can be prepared in advance, making them a great option for busy hosts.

Finally, Daphne Oz shares her recipe for a "Creamy Lemon Dip," which is the perfect accompaniment to any potluck spread. The dip only requires a few ingredients, including Greek yogurt, lemon zest, and garlic, making it a quick and budget-friendly option.

Throughout the episode, the hosts share their tips and tricks for hosting a successful potluck party. They discuss the importance of communication with guests, assigning dishes to ensure a variety of options, and how to accommodate dietary restrictions and allergies.
